From the organizer
The Live Your Dash 5k and Fun Run is in beautiful downtown Historic Edenton. The race is an up and back course from Water Street to Hayes Plantation.
Join us Friday 9/18 for the packet pickup at Edenton Bay Trading Company from 5:30 pm-7:30 pm for fun and music!
Registration for 5K is $45 and includes a t-shirt, BBQ lunch and a drink ticket. Register by September 8th for guaranteed t-shirt size.
Registration for Fun Run is $25 t-shirt and hot dog plate.
Awards For Top 3 Male and Female in each category: 19 and Under; 20-29; 30-39; 40-49; 50-59; 60 and Over
The after party and awards ceremony will take place at The Herringbone. A BBQ lunch and 1 drink ticket will be provided for participants. Plates will be sold for $10 for non-participants. Proceeds from the event benefit the George & Alex Memorial Foundation, awarding a $20,000 scholarship to a John A. Holmes senior.
Race course: The race begins across from Chowan Arts Council (112 W Water Street) to the Hayes bridge crossing over to beautiful Hayes Plantation and turn around at the house and back to W Water Street.
